GFL1-100 Electromagnetic Residual Current Operated Circuit Breaker(RCCB)
GFL1-100 Electromagnetic Residual Current Operated Circuit Breaker (RCCB) is a high-capacity magnetic type RCCB designed for industrial and commercial applications. It is capable of handling currents up to 100A, providing reliable electrical leakage protection for personnel and equipment.
● Standard: ( A、AC、S)IEC/EN 61008-1, (F)IEC/EN 62423,(EV)IEC/EN 62955
● Type: AC、A、EV、F、S
● Rated current: 63A、80A、100A
● Rated voltage: 230/400V~240/415V
● Poles: 2P(1P+N), 4P(3P+N), N Pole on left
● Rated Residual Operating Current (IΔn): 10mA,30mA,100mA,300mA,500mA
● Rated short-circuit breaking capacity: 6kA
● Ambient air temperature: -35...+70 ºC
● Connection: From top and bottom
● Certificates: CB,CE,UKCA, SEMKO

●Product Model Overview
Type | Summary |
AC mould RCCB | The RCCB can be ensured to trip by a sudden application or slow rise of the remaining sinusoidal AC current |
A mould RCCB | The RCCB can be ensured to trip for a sudden application or slow rise of residual sinusoidal alternating current and residual pulsating DC current |
S mould RCCB | It also has sufficient ability to withstand the trip even when surge voltage causes flashover and generates commutation |
EV mouldA+6 RCCB | RCCB for electric vehicle charging piles |

●Technical Parameters
Product Model | GFL1-100 |
Standard | ( A、AC、S)IEC61008-1, (F)IEC62423,(EV)IEC62955 |
No. of poles | 2P(1P+N), 4P(3P+N), N Pole on left |
Rated current In | 2P: 63A,80A,100A |
4P: 63A,80A,100A | |
Rated voltage Ue | 2P(1P+N): 230/240V, 4P(3P+N): 240/400/415V |
Rated Breaking Capacity | 6kA |
Contact position indicator | green OFF / red ON |
Protection | Ground fault |
Type of trip | Electro-magnetic |
Residual current type | B: residual AC, pulsating and smooth DC current, high frequency (≤1kHz) |
Rated residual operation current(I△n) | 10, 30, 100, 300,500mA |
Insulation voltage Ui | 500V |
Rated frequency | 50/60Hz |
Rated residual making and breaking capacity (I△m) | 500A (In≤50A), 10In (In>50A) |
Short-circuit current Inc= I△c | 10,000A |
SCPD fuse | 10,000A |
Residual current off-time under I△n | ≤0.1s |
Rated impulse withstands voltage (1.5/50) Uimp | 4000V |
Dielectric test voltage at ind. Freq. for 1min | 2.5kV |
Electrical life | 2,000 Cycles |
Mechanical life | 4,000 Cycles |
Ground fault indicator | White: Normal, Red: Leakage fault |
Protection degree | IP40 |
Ambient temperature | -35℃~+70℃, Max.95% humidity |
Terminal connection type | Cable/Pin-type busbar/Fork-type busbar |
Installation | Mounting on 35mm DIN rail |
Max. terminal size for cable | 35mm² |
Max. tightening torque | 2.5N·m |
Connection | Bi-directional |

●Leakage Protection Type and Scope
| Circuit | Normal loop current | Current in the lower circuit under ground fault | Leakage detection type | |||
| AC | A | F | EV/A+6 | |||
Single-phase | ![]() | ![]() | √ | √ | √ | √ |
Phase control | ![]() | ![]() | √ | √ | √ | √ |
Impulse control, pulse control | ![]() | ![]() | × | √ | √ | √ |
Single phase half wave rectification | ![]() | ![]() | × | √ | √ | √ |
Single phase full wave rectification | ![]() | ![]() | × | √ | √ | √ |
Single phase full wave rectification half wave phase control | ![]() | ![]() | × | √ | √ | √ |
Partial full wave rectification | ![]() | ![]() | × | × | √ | √ |
Single phase half wave rectification with filter | ![]() | ![]() | × | × | × | √ |
Three phase half wave rectification | ![]() | ![]() | × | × | × | √ |
Three phase full wave rectification with filter | ![]() | ![]() | × | × | × | √ |
